oracle静默安装
1.1解压安装包Oracle11gR2安装为两个安装包,全部解压后,需要将两个安装包的内容合并在一起后进行安装 2.1.1. 上传和解压oracle用户上传和解压。 unziplinux.x64_11gR2_database_1of2.zip unziplinux.x64_11gR2_database_2of2.zip 1.2Oracle数据库安装 2.2.1. 有网络安装依赖包yum install binutilscompat-libstdc++-33 elfutils-libelf elfutils-libelf-devel glibc glibc-commonglibc-devel gcc- gcc-c++ libaio-devel libaio libgcc libstdc++ libstdc++-develmake sysstat unixODBC unixODBC-devel pdksh 2.2.2. 没有网络安装依赖包请先上传rpm.zip,然后解压 unzip rpm.zip 然后执行 rpm -ivh *.rpm --nodeps Cforce 2.2.3. 创建Oracle安装用户groupadd oinstall groupadd dba useradd -g oinstall -G dbaoracle Cd /home/oracle/ passwd oracle 2.2.4. 修改内核参数打开修改/etc/sysctl.conf,在最后加入以下内容 fs.aio-max-nr = 1048576 fs.file-max = 6815744 kernel.shmall = 2097152 kernel.shmmax = 536870912 kernel.shmmni = 4096 kernel.sem = 250 32000 100 128 net.ipv4.ip_local_port_range =9000 65500 net.core.rmem_default = 262144 net.core.rmem_max = 4194304 net.core.wmem_default = 262144 net.core.wmem_max = 1048576 修改后使用/sbin/sysctl Cp刷新,使设置生效。 2.2.5. 更改用户限制修改 /etc/security/limits.conf,加入内容 oracle soft nproc 2047 oracle hard nproc 16384 oracle soft nofile 1024 oracle hard nofile 65536 2.2.6. 改系统环境变量修改环境变量/etc/profile,加入以下内容 if [ $USER = "oracle"]; then if[ $SHELL = "/bin/ksh" ]; then ulimit -p 16384 ulimit -n 65536 else ulimit -u 16384 -n 65536 fi fi 2.2.7. 设置Oracle环境变量export PATH export ORACLE_SID=orcl exportORACLE_BASE=/home/oracle/app exportORACLE_HOME=$ORACLE_BASE/product/11.2.0/dbhome_1 exportPATH=$PATH:$HOME/bin:$ORACLE_HOME/bin exportLD_LIBRARY_PATH=$ORACLE_HOME/lib:/usr/lib 2.2.8. 配置db_install.rsp已经打包在db_install.zip里面。 更改选项: oracle.install.option=INSTALL_DB_SWONLY // 安装类型 ORACLE_HOSTNAME=10.10.17.161 // 主机名称(改成ip地址就行) UNIX_GROUP_NAME=oinstall // 安装组 INVENTORY_LOCATION=/ home/oracle/app //INVENTORY目录(默认写BASE就行) SELECTED_LANGUAGES=en,zh_CN,zh_TW// 选择语言 ORACLE_HOME=/ home/oracle/app/product/11.2.0/dbhome_1 //oracle_home ORACLE_BASE=/ home/oracle/app //oracle_base oracle.install.db.InstallEdition=EE // oracle版本 oracle.install.db.DBA_GROUP=dba/ / dba用户组 oracle.install.db.OPER_GROUP=oinstall// oper用户组 oracle.install.db.config.starterdb.type=GENERAL_PURPOSE//数据库类型 oracle.install.db.config.starterdb.globalDBName=orcl//globalDBName 全局数据库名称 oracle.install.db.config.starterdb.password.ALL=oracle//默认密码 2.2.9. 执行安装命令./runInstaller Csilent -force-ignorePrereq -responseFile /home/oracle/db_install.rsp 需要等待,切换到root账户,执行两个脚本。 2.2.10. 安装全局数据库配置dbca.rsp 已经打包在dbca.zip里面。 执行命令开始安装dbca -silent -responseFile/home/oracle/dbca.rsp 日志:/home/oracle/app/cfgtoollogs/dbca/orcl/trace.log 执行后开始清屏,然后直接输入之前设置的默认密码敲回车,就自动开始安装了。 2.2.11. 配置监听文件两个监听文件,已经打包在jianting.zip里面。对应修改以下配置: listener: HOST = 192.168.0.250 //服务器地址 PORT = 1521 //监听的端口 ORACLE_HOME=/home/oracle/app/product/11.2.0/dbhome_1 //指定oracle的home tnsnames: HOST = 192.168.0.250 //服务器地址 PORT = 1521 //监听的端口 配置完后,放到/ home /oracle/app/product/11.2.0/dbhome_1/network/admin/下。 lsnrctl start,启动oracle监听。 (编辑:商洛站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|